Transaction 95a01ec15a72ed3e81966083f99da777a01bef6fb8106df00f184a2017883960
1 Input
2 Outputs
- 95a01ec15a72ed3e81966083f99da777a01bef6fb8106df00f184a2017883960:0
- 95a01ec15a72ed3e81966083f99da777a01bef6fb8106df00f184a2017883960:1
value 527273
address 39FxHjppojKZEn9RZ3uc6KZgeJNnBorU69
value 24099
address 1EK84TDjaM4Sx94eu4PbxgAnFk2ReXD3h5